Gustavo Ballesteros is a sophomore at Northwestern University, majoring in Civil Engineering and pursuing a Master of Science in Project Management. He has worked on the policy, design, engineering, and advocacy aspects of sustainable and resilient infrastructure. As a designer for the Design Apprenticeship Program at the National Building Museum, he collaborated with industry professionals and community leaders in southeast DC to transform recreational spaces into lively, modern community hubs. As an intern at Clean Water Action, Gustavo researched and advocated for numerous environmental causes around Maryland, including analyzing Baltimore City sewage backups affecting more than 50,000 residents and testifying for the restriction of unrecyclable plastics and plastic straws in Montgomery County...
